At least 50 people were killed in Ethiopia’s Oromiya region in demonstrations following the deadly shooting of a popular singer, a regional spokesman announced on Wednesday.
Musician Haacaaluu Hundeessaa was shot dead on Monday night in what police stated was a targeted killing.
Rallies resounding anger at the killing of a popular figure and a sense of political marginalisation broke out the next morning in the capital and other towns and cities in the surrounding Oromiya region.
The dead included protesters and members of the security forces, spokesman Getachew Balcha said. Some businesses had also been set on fire.
